In the Hornady app, if you go into the table and scroll right it lists the no-wind trajectory and the aerodynamic jump separately.

For my .223 with 80gr smk and 12mph 90° wind it is saying .22 mil.

.22 mil being aerodynamic jump - the difference between a 90° wind and the no-wind trajectory. So the difference between a right and left 90° would be .44 mil.
